学web 前端要学什么
-
学习Web前端需要掌握以下内容:
-
HTML(超文本标记语言):学习HTML是前端开发的基础。掌握HTML的语法规则、标签的使用及其属性的含义,能够搭建基本的网页结构。
-
CSS(层叠样式表):学习CSS的目的是为了掌握页面的样式设计。学习如何使用CSS来控制字体、颜色、布局等方面,使页面更加美观和易读。
-
JavaScript(JS):学习JavaScript是实现网页交互的关键。了解JavaScript的语法规则、变量、函数、事件等概念,能够实现页面的动态效果、表单验证以及与后端进行数据交互。
-
前端框架:学习一些流行的前端框架,如React、Vue等,能够提高开发效率和代码质量。掌握这些框架的基本原理,能够进行组件化开发、状态管理和路由等。
-
响应式设计和移动端适配:学习如何使网页适应不同屏幕尺寸的设备,使用户在不同设备上都能获得良好的用户体验。
-
跨域和性能优化:学习如何解决跨域问题,以及如何对网页进行性能优化,减少加载时间,提高用户访问体验。
-
学习工具和版本控制:熟悉常用的前端开发工具,如代码编辑器、命令行工具等,并学会使用版本控制工具,如Git,进行代码的版本管理。
-
学习与后端交互:了解后端开发的基本知识,能够与后端进行数据交互,实现前后端的配合开发。
除了以上的内容,持续的学习和实践也是非常重要的,要多做项目练习,不断提升自己的编程能力和解决问题的能力。同时要关注前端行业的最新动态,学习最新的技术和工具。
1年前 -
-
学习Web前端开发需要掌握以下内容:
-
HTML和CSS:HTML(Hypertext Markup Language)是用于构建网页结构的标记语言,CSS(Cascading Style Sheets)用于为网页添加样式。掌握HTML和CSS可以实现页面的基本布局和样式设计。
-
JavaScript:JavaScript是一种用于网页交互和动态效果的脚本语言。学习JavaScript可以增加页面的交互性和动态性,如表单验证、DOM操作、事件处理等。
-
前端框架:掌握一种或多种前端框架可以提高开发效率和代码质量。常用的前端框架包括React、Angular和Vue.js等。这些框架提供了一系列的组件和工具,可以简化和加速开发过程。
-
前端工具:掌握一些常用的前端工具可以提高工作效率。例如,代码编辑器(如VS Code)、版本控制工具(如Git)、构建工具(如Webpack)等。
-
响应式设计和移动优化:现代网页应该适应不同设备和屏幕尺寸。学习响应式设计可以使网页在不同设备上都具备良好的用户体验。移动优化是指针对移动设备进行网页设计和优化,例如通过媒体查询实现不同屏幕尺寸下的布局和样式调整。
-
浏览器兼容性:不同的浏览器对Web标准的支持不一致,学习如何处理不同浏览器的兼容性问题是非常重要的。
-
SEO优化:学习如何优化网页以提高搜索引擎的排名。了解常用的SEO技术和策略,如合适的网页结构、关键词优化、友好的URL等。
-
数据交互和API:学习如何通过AJAX或其他方式与后端API进行数据交互,实现网页的动态内容加载和更新。
-
性能优化:了解网页加载时间的影响因素,学习如何优化网页以提高性能,如合理使用缓存、压缩资源、减少HTTP请求等。
-
其他技术:学习其他相关的技术可以进一步提升前端开发的能力,如CSS预处理器(如Sass、Less)、后端语言(如PHP、Python)、数据库知识(如MySQL)等。
总之,学习Web前端开发需要全面掌握HTML、CSS和JavaScript,并深入了解相关框架、工具和技术,不断学习和实践,才能成为一名优秀的前端开发人员。
1年前 -
-
学习Web前端需要掌握以下内容:
-
HTML (超文本标记语言):HTML是构建Web页面的基础,学习HTML可以理解Web页面的结构、标签和元素等。同时还要掌握HTML5的新特性,如语义化标签、媒体标签等。
-
CSS (层叠样式表):CSS用来描述Web页面的外观和样式,通过CSS可以控制字体、颜色、布局、动画效果等。学习CSS需要了解选择器、盒子模型、样式继承等基本概念,同时还要了解CSS3的新特性,如Flexbox布局、过渡和动画等。
-
JavaScript (JS):作为一门脚本语言,JavaScript可以为Web页面增加动态交互和功能。学习JavaScript需要了解基本语法、数据类型、变量、循环、函数等基础知识,同时还要掌握DOM操作、事件处理、AJAX等高级技术。
-
前端框架和库:掌握一种或多种前端框架和库可以提高开发效率和代码质量。常见的框架包括React、Angular、Vue等,常见的库包括jQuery、Lodash等。学习框架和库需要了解它们的基本原理、使用方法和常见问题解决方案。
-
响应式设计:随着移动设备的普及,响应式设计成为一个重要的前端概念。学习响应式设计需要了解媒体查询、流式布局、弹性布局等技术,以便能够在不同设备上提供良好的用户体验。
-
浏览器和调试工具:了解不同浏览器的特点和兼容性问题,并掌握调试工具的使用,可以帮助解决兼容性、性能和调试等方面的问题。常见的浏览器包括Chrome、Firefox、Safari和Edge等,常用的调试工具包括开发者工具和Firebug等。
-
版本控制和团队协作:学习版本控制系统如Git,掌握基本的分支管理、合并和冲突解决等操作,有利于团队协作和代码管理。
此外,还可以学习一些辅助工具和技术,如包管理工具npm、构建工具Webpack、任务运行器Gulp等,以提高开发效率和项目管理能力。还可以学习一些视觉设计和交互设计的基本知识,以便能够更好地与设计师合作。
总之,学习Web前端需要不断学习和实践,并且保持对新技术的敏感度,随时跟进并学习新的前端技术和趋势。
1年前 -